WoWInterface SVN PhanxConfigWidgets

Compare Revisions

  • This comparison shows the changes necessary to convert path
    /trunk/PhanxConfig-Panel
    from Rev 28 to Rev 35
    Reverse comparison

Rev 28 → Rev 35

PhanxConfig-Panel.lua
12,7 → 12,11
local lib, oldminor = LibStub:NewLibrary("PhanxConfig-Panel", MINOR_VERSION)
if not lib then return end
 
local panelBackdrop = GameTooltip:GetBackdrop()
local panelBackdrop = {
bgFile = [[Interface\Tooltips\UI-Tooltip-Background]], tile = true, tileSize = 16,
edgeFile = [[Interface\Tooltips\UI-Tooltip-Border]], edgeSize = 16,
insets = { left = 5, right = 5, top = 5, bottom = 5 }
}
 
function lib.CreatePanel(parent, width, height)
local frame = CreateFrame("Frame", nil, parent)
20,8 → 24,8
frame:SetFrameLevel(parent:GetFrameLevel() + 1)
 
frame:SetBackdrop(panelBackdrop)
frame:SetBackdropColor(0.1, 0.1, 0.1, 0.5)
frame:SetBackdropBorderColor(0.8, 0.8, 0.8, 0.5)
frame:SetBackdropColor(0.06, 0.06, 0.06, 0.4)
frame:SetBackdropBorderColor(0.6, 0.6, 0.6, 1)
 
frame:SetWidth(width or 1)
frame:SetHeight(height or 1)